Anthropic Launches Claude for Healthcare with HIPAA-Ready Infrastructure

Anthropic introduced Claude for Healthcare with HIPAA compliance and expanded life sciences connectors, enabling healthcare organizations to deploy AI assistants for clinical and research workflows.

Anthropic has launched Claude for Healthcare, a comprehensive platform featuring HIPAA-ready infrastructure, healthcare-specific model capabilities, and native integrations with medical databases. The launch positions Claude as the only major foundation model available with HIPAA-compliant infrastructure across all major cloud providers.

HIPAA-Ready Infrastructure

Claude for Healthcare operates under business associate agreements (BAAs) through multiple cloud platforms:

  • AWS Bedrock: HIPAA-compliant deployment option
  • Google Cloud: Protected health information support
  • Microsoft Azure: Enterprise healthcare integration

Anthropic explicitly states they do not use user health data to train models. Consumer health data shared with Claude is excluded from model memory and storage, with all data sharing opt-in.

Healthcare Capabilities

The platform includes native integrations with commonly-used medical and scientific databases:

  • CMS Coverage Database: Medicare and Medicaid coverage requirements
  • ICD-10 codes: Diagnostic and procedure coding support
  • PubMed: Medical literature and research access

Key Use Cases

Claude for Healthcare targets several high-value applications:

  • Prior authorization: Speed up approval requests for life-saving care
  • Care coordination: Reduce administrative burden on clinicians
  • Regulatory submissions: Accelerate drug approval documentation
  • Coverage determination: Check clinical criteria against patient records

Consumer Health Features

For individual users, Claude Pro and Max subscribers in the United States can now:

  • Connect personal health data through HealthEx and Function
  • Integrate with Apple Health and Android Health Connect
  • Summarize medical history and explain test results
  • Prepare questions for doctor appointments

Market Context

The launch comes just days after OpenAI introduced ChatGPT Health, signaling intensifying competition in healthcare AI. The healthcare sector represents both a major opportunity and a sensitive testing ground for generative AI technology, where accuracy, privacy, and safety are paramount.

Target Customers

Claude for Healthcare serves three primary segments:

  • Healthcare providers: Hospitals, clinics, and health systems
  • Payers: Insurance companies and benefits administrators
  • Life sciences: Pharmaceutical and biotech companies
